Cleveland, OH 44114 (216) 771-1943; Public ... WebCleveland RTA Rapid Transit. The Red Line is a rapid transit line in Cleveland, United States. The RTA Rapid Transit system operates it, and Red Line has 18 stations running from Hopkins International Airport to East Cleveland. WebGreater Cleveland is the largest metropolitan area in Ohio. The larger Cleveland- Akron -Elyria Combined Statistical Area is the 14th-largest Combined Statistical Area in the United States , and includes the above counties plus Ashtabula County , Portage County and Summit County , with a population of 2,881,937.
